一、基本介绍 1. 推荐系统任务 推荐系统的任务就是联系用户和信息一方面帮助用户发现对自己有价值的信息,而另一方面让信息能够展现在对它感兴趣的用户面前从而实现信息消费者和信息生产者的双赢。 2. 与搜索引擎比较 相同点:帮助用户快速发现有用信息的工具 不同点:和搜索引擎不同的是推荐 ...
前言:由于近期项目上在开发一个销售管理系统,里面涉及到一个基于用户的产品给推荐算法,之前也对推荐系统有比较系统地了解,因此本文及接下来的几篇文章将详细推荐系统的思想及其多中实现方法,本篇将主要介绍基于系统过滤的推荐系统及其Python实现。 协同过滤思想 协同过滤 collabrotive filtering 是商品销售 尤其是网店 常用的推荐方法,分为基于用户 user based 和基于商品 ...
2017-03-02 20:46 0 2448 推荐指数:
一、基本介绍 1. 推荐系统任务 推荐系统的任务就是联系用户和信息一方面帮助用户发现对自己有价值的信息,而另一方面让信息能够展现在对它感兴趣的用户面前从而实现信息消费者和信息生产者的双赢。 2. 与搜索引擎比较 相同点:帮助用户快速发现有用信息的工具 不同点:和搜索引擎不同的是推荐 ...
本节将会学习到: 协同过滤推荐系统 协同过滤推荐系统的R实现 推荐系统的可视化 不同推荐系统的离线实验算法比较及可视化 前言 推荐系统概述 数据构成 set.seed ( 1234 ) library ...
3. 基于协同过滤的推荐算法 (用户和物品的关联) 协同过滤(Collaborative Filtering,CF)-- 用户和物品之间关联的用户行为数据 ①基于近邻的协同过滤 ...
这个转自csdn,很贴近工程。 协同过滤(Collective Filtering)可以说是推荐系统的标配算法。 在谈推荐必谈协同的今天,我们也来谈一谈基于KNN的协同过滤在实际的推荐应用中的一些心得体会。 我们首先从协同过滤的两个假设聊起。 两个假设: 用户一般会喜欢 ...
一、基本介绍 1. 推荐系统任务 推荐系统的任务就是联系用户和信息一方面帮助用户发现对自己有价值的信息,而另一方面让信息能够展现在对它感兴趣的用户面前从而实现信息消费者和信息生产者的双赢。 2. 与搜索引擎比较 相同点:帮助用户快速发现有用信息的工具 不同点:和搜索引擎 ...
一、背景 某电商平台,有一批用户浏览、收藏、购买物品的日志数据。实现用户进入APP之后第一页显示商品的个性化推荐。ps:当前阶段,显示数据为随机选取。 二、思考 1、因为是某一品类的特殊电商平台,卖的商品几百种,但是用户几十万。这种情况,考虑使用ItemCF,至于为什么不是UserCF:物品 ...
的高低,在学生选课时进行推荐。 2、推荐算法的实现思路 欧氏距离相似性度量 在数学中,欧几里得距离或 ...
。协同过滤通常分为基于用户的协同过滤和基于商品的协同过滤。 基于用户的协同过滤:利用用户之间的相 ...